drm/i915: Introduce crtc_state->update_planes bitmask



Keep track which planes need updating during the commit. For now
we set the bit for any plane that was or will be visible (including
icl+ nv12 slave planes). In the future I'll have need to update
invisible planes as well, for skl plane ddbs and for pre-skl pipe
gamma/csc control (which lives in the primary plane control register).

v2: Pimp the commit message to mention icl+ nv12 slave planes (Matt)
